Meaning of KNOTGRASS

Pronunciation:  'nât`gras

 Sponsored Links: 
 
WordNet Dictionary
 
 Definition: [n]  low-growing weedy grass with spikelets along the leaf stems
 
 Synonyms: Paspalum distichum
 
 See Also: genus Paspalum, grass

 

 

Webster's 1913 Dictionary
 
 Definition: 
\Knot"grass`\, n. (Bot.)
(a) a common weed with jointed stems {(Polygonum aviculare)};
    knotweed.
(b) The dog grass. See under {Dog}.

Note: An infusion of {Polygonum aviculare} was once supposed
      to have the effect of stopping the growth of an animal,
      and hence it was called, as by Shakespeare, ``hindering
      knotgrass.''

            We want a boy extremely for this function, Kept
            under for a year with milk and knotgrass. --Beau.
                                               & Fl.
